产品面试真题解析09:如何平衡新老用户的产品体验
新用户希望产品易于上手、快速感知价值,而老用户则追求功能深度、操作习惯的延续性以及个性化体验。这种需求的差异,使得产品经理在设计产品时必须具备敏锐的用户洞察力和精准的权衡能力。本文将深入剖析一道产品面试真题——“如何平衡新老用户的产品体验”,并结合 NOBLE 模型,从需求分析、入门体验设计、向后兼容、分层体验构建到用户成长路径规划等多个维度,提供一套系统化的解决方案。
今天解析一道揭示产品经理平衡艺术的面试题:如何确保产品设计同时满足新用户和老用户的需求?这个问题考验的是产品经理的用户洞察力和权衡取舍能力
面试官为什么问这个问题?
面试官通过这个问题主要考察以下能力:
- 平衡思维:你是否能平衡增长与留存的关系
- 用户细分:你是否能深入理解不同用户群体的差异化需求
- 产品设计:你是否有具体方法解决新老用户体验冲突
- 增长思维:你如何看待用户生命周期和价值转化
- 实验意识:你是否会通过数据验证来指导决策
本质上,面试官想了解:你能否在满足老用户忠诚度的同时,降低新用户入门门槛,实现产品的可持续增长。
常见误区:大多数候选人怎么答错的?
- 过度偏向一方:”获取新用户更重要”或”留存老用户才是核心”等极端观点
- 简单化处理:”提供个性化设置让用户自己选择”而不考虑实际可行性
- 忽视冲突本质:未能识别新老用户需求和行为模式的本质差异
- 抽象空谈:只提概念性解决方案,缺乏具体设计手段
- 缺乏分析框架:没有系统性思考如何判断和处理新老用户的平衡
答题框架:NOBLE模型
回答新老用户平衡问题,我推荐使用NOBLE框架:
- N – Needs Analysis (需求分析):分析新老用户的差异化需求
- O – Onboarding Design (入门体验):设计流畅的新用户入门体验
- B – Backward Compatibility (向后兼容):保障老用户的使用习惯
- L – Layered Experience (分层体验):构建递进式的功能体验层次
- E – Evolution Path (演进路径):规划用户从新手到专家的转化路径
内容深度:核心要点必须覆盖
平衡新老用户体验时,必须涵盖以下关键点:
- 用户分层策略:基于使用频率、熟悉度等维度的用户分层方法
- 渐进式体验:从简单到复杂的功能展示和学习曲线设计
- 关键功能识别:区分核心功能与高级功能的方法
- 平衡点量化:用数据衡量新老用户平衡决策的效果
- 迁移策略:产品改版时的用户迁移和教育策略
加分项:如何脱颖而出
想要在回答中展现高级产品思维:
- 心智模型分析:讨论新老用户的不同心智模型和认知差异
- A/B测试策略:提出如何通过实验验证平衡策略的有效性
- 设计模式引用:提及专业UI/UX设计模式,如渐进式披露原则
- 增长模型关联:将新老用户体验与AARRR增长模型关联
- 成本效益分析:分析平衡策略的投入产出比和优先级
资深产品总监参考答案
平衡新老用户的需求是产品可持续增长的关键。我采用NOBLE模型来系统化解决这一挑战。
需求分析阶段:
首先,深入理解新老用户的本质差异。新用户通常关注:学习成本低、价值快速感知、核心功能明确;而老用户关注:效率提升、功能完备性、操作习惯稳定性、个性化需求满足。
我会通过用户分层研究,将用户按使用频率、熟练度和价值贡献划分为初级用户、中级用户和专家用户。对每层用户,我们定义清晰的核心场景和关键任务,确保功能设计能覆盖各层用户的核心需求。
入门体验设计:
为新用户,我设计”低地板”策略:
- 简化首次使用流程,减少必要步骤
- 聚焦核心价值,首页呈现最具吸引力的功能
- 设计引导式教程,采用情景化引导而非抽象说明
- 提供”快速成功”路径,让用户快速体验到产品价值
例如,在我负责的协作工具中,新用户首次登录会直接看到预设模板,一键即可开始使用,而不是面对空白页面。
向后兼容设计:
为老用户,我采取”不伤害”原则:
- 保留核心操作路径和快捷键,避免破坏肌肉记忆
- 功能调整时提供过渡期和切换选项
- 重大变更前进行小范围测试,获取老用户反馈
- 为老用户提供新功能的上下文提示,减少学习成本
在产品改版时,我们通常保留至少3个月的旧版入口,让老用户有充分时间适应变化。
分层体验构建:
核心策略是”高天花板,宽通道”:
- 界面设计遵循”常用80%,可见性高;非常用20%,触手可及”原则
- 采用渐进式披露模式,基础功能直观可见,高级功能通过适当路径触达
- 设置可定制的界面密度和功能展示
- 提供多种操作路径,满足不同熟练度用户的效率需求
在我们的产品中,主界面保持简洁,但通过右键菜单、快捷键、高级设置面板等方式,为专业用户提供强大功能。
演进路径规划:
最重要的是设计用户成长路径:
- 建立清晰的用户成长模型,定义从新手到专家的进阶标志
- 设计功能发现机制,适时向用户推荐更高级功能
- 提供学习资源和社区支持,鼓励用户技能提升
- 通过适当激励机制,引导用户探索更多功能价值
例如,我们会在用户完成基础任务后,通过适当的提示引导他们尝试更高级的功能,并提供相关学习资源。
实际案例:
以我负责的数据分析产品为例,我们面临典型的新老用户平衡挑战:新用户觉得专业复杂,老用户需要高效强大的功能。
我们采用了多层级解决方案:
- 引入项目模板库,新用户可以基于模板快速开始
- 设计”简洁模式”和”专业模式”两种界面,用户可以根据需求切换
- 核心分析功能采用向导式+自由式双重交互模式
- 为高级用户提供API和脚本支持,满足定制化需求
- 设计”技能树”成长体系,引导用户逐步掌握高级功能
实施后,我们的新用户1周留存率提升了35%,同时专业用户满意度维持在90%以上,证明了平衡策略的有效性。
我认为,平衡新老用户需求不是简单的非此即彼选择,而是通过分层设计、渐进式体验和清晰的用户成长路径,创造一个既易于入门又不限制成长的产品生态。
本文由 @Kris 原创发布于人人都是产品经理。未经作者许可,禁止转载
题图来自Unsplash,基于CC0协议
- 目前还没评论,等你发挥!